(PARI)
N = 22; S = 5;
M = matrix(N+1, N*numerator(S)+1);
Mget(n, j) = { M[1 + n, 1 + j*denominator(S)] };
Mset(n, j, v) = { M[1 + n, 1 + j*denominator(S)] = v };
Minit() = {
my(step = 1/denominator(S));
Mset(0, 0, 1);
for (n = 1, N, forstep (j = 0, n*S, step,
my(acc = 0);
for (k = abs(j-S), min(j+S, (n-1)*S), acc += Mget(n-1, k));
Mset(n, j, acc)));
};
Minit();
vector(1 + N\denominator(S), n, Mget((n-1)*denominator(S), 0))
(PARI) c(j, n) = sum(k=0, min((j + 5*n)\11, n), (-1)^k*binomial(n, k)*binomial(j - 11*k + n + 5*n - 1, j - 11*k + n*5))